{"id":18113339,"url":"https://github.com/alexanderlapygin/cra_ts_rtl_msw_react-query","last_synced_at":"2026-04-15T09:38:14.577Z","repository":{"id":132568678,"uuid":"445095150","full_name":"AlexanderLapygin/cra_ts_rtl_msw_react-query","owner":"AlexanderLapygin","description":"CRA-in-TS starter with React Query and testing with RTL and MSW","archived":false,"fork":false,"pushed_at":"2022-01-09T02:07:23.000Z","size":401,"stargazers_count":0,"open_issues_count":0,"forks_count":0,"subscribers_count":1,"default_branch":"master","last_synced_at":"2025-04-06T08:48:14.490Z","etag":null,"topics":["cra","msw","react","react-query","react-testing-library","rtl","softspiders","ss","starter","template","test","testing","ts"],"latest_commit_sha":null,"homepage":"","language":"TypeScript","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/AlexanderLapygin.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2022-01-06T08:25:18.000Z","updated_at":"2022-01-09T03:17:41.000Z","dependencies_parsed_at":null,"dependency_job_id":"49110345-bf9e-4647-84a3-014b550094f4","html_url":"https://github.com/AlexanderLapygin/cra_ts_rtl_msw_react-query","commit_stats":null,"previous_names":[],"tags_count":0,"template":true,"template_full_name":"softspiders/cra-typescript-test","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/AlexanderLapygin%2Fcra_ts_rtl_msw_react-query","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/AlexanderLapygin%2Fcra_ts_rtl_msw_react-query/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/AlexanderLapygin%2Fcra_ts_rtl_msw_react-query/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/AlexanderLapygin%2Fcra_ts_rtl_msw_react-query/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/AlexanderLapygin","download_url":"https://codeload.github.com/AlexanderLapygin/cra_ts_rtl_msw_react-query/tar.gz/refs/heads/master","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":247457746,"owners_count":20941906,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["cra","msw","react","react-query","react-testing-library","rtl","softspiders","ss","starter","template","test","testing","ts"],"created_at":"2024-11-01T02:07:35.847Z","updated_at":"2026-04-15T09:38:14.483Z","avatar_url":"https://github.com/AlexanderLapygin.png","language":"TypeScript","funding_links":[],"categories":[],"sub_categories":[],"readme":"\u003cdiv align=\"center\"\u003e\n    \u003ca href=\"https://github.com/softspiders/softspiders\"\u003e\n      \u003cimg src=\"https://avatars.githubusercontent.com/u/47006425?v=4\"width=\"100\" height=\"100\"/\u003e\n    \u003c/a\u003e\n\u003c/div\u003e\n\n# CRA-in-TS starter with React Query and testing with RTL and MSW\n\n## Feature tags\n\n- create-react-app\n- mock-server-worker\n- react\n- react-query\n- react-testing-library\n- rest\n- starter\n- template\n- testing\n- typescript\n\n---\n\n## Direct ancestors\n\n- [***- react-query***: cra_ts_rtl_msw](https://github.com/AlexanderLapygin/cra_ts_rtl_msw)\n- [***-ts***: cra_rtl_msw_react-query](https://github.com/AlexanderLapygin/cra_rtl_msw_react-query)\n\n## Direct descendants\n\n[***+ openapi-backend***: cra_ts_react-query_rtl_msw_openapi-backend](https://github.com/AlexanderLapygin/cra_ts_react-query_rtl_msw_openapi-backend)\n\n---\n\n## Requirements\n\n* [Node.js](https://nodejs.org/en/download/package-manager/)\n\n## Installation\n\nBeing in the repository root directory, run:\n\n```sh\nyarn\n```\n\n## Running\n\nBeing in the repository root directory, run:\n\n```sh\nyarn start\n```\n\n## Running test (in watch mode)\n\nBeing in the repository root directory, run:\n\n```sh\nyarn test\n```\n\n## Authors\n\n[Alexander Lapygin](https://github.com/AlexanderLapygin)\n\n## Inspired by\n\n[Develop and test React apps with React Query, MSW and React Testing Library (Dennis Kortsch)](https://www.denniskortsch.de/posts/msw-react-testing)\n\n### License\n\nLicensed under the [MIT license](./LICENSE).\n\n---\n\n[SOFTSPIDERS](https://github.com/softspiders/softspiders)\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Falexanderlapygin%2Fcra_ts_rtl_msw_react-query","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Falexanderlapygin%2Fcra_ts_rtl_msw_react-query","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Falexanderlapygin%2Fcra_ts_rtl_msw_react-query/lists"}